ICESCAPE mission supplies retrieval, aerial photograph. Crew from the ICESCAPE mission retrieving a supply canister dropped by parachute from a C-130 aircraft. The ICESCAPE mission, or 'Impacts of Climate on Ecosystems and Chemistry of the Arctic Pacific Environment', is NASA's two-year shipborne investigation to study how changing conditions in the Arctic affect the ocean's chemistry and ecosystems. The bulk of the research took place in the Beaufort and Chukchi seas in the summers of 2010 and 2011. The two crew-members here are from the US Coast Guard Cutter Healy. Photographed on 12 July 2011. | |
